Fitted mine this morning. Paddles work fine without doing anything else, but having the acc button caused epc errors to come up. Cleared and immediately back again. I think it’s option in the acc modules for “enable nar” that needs to be set to active, but it seems this module is locked down as VCP was refused write access..
so then transferred my old buttons to new wheel. And all good, just no acc.

Very interesting… By ACC module you mean the radar module? Any idea what “enable nar” possibly means? What were the ECP errors, which module?

The other thread on the same subject ( Carista ) was left at the point where it seemed that the next step to enable ACC would have been to change cruise control setup in the engine ECU. That was based on what the visibility through the VCDS. Have you had a deeper look with VCP there?

I think that path was not yet tried as the ACC buttons on steering wheel were still missing then. The radar modules had identical part numbers and also the documented codings were a proper match.
